Hello, I have a T40 for some years. The last mainboard had the USB problem (not working on 2.0), and finally appeared the Ati flexing problem (freeze screen for graphics bad soldering).
Now I´m using my first mainboard that doesn´t charge the battery (I damaged it with an external bad battery).

Well, on the near future (from now to summer) I want to buy another laptop, because I will need expresscard. From some time I was thinking in T43, but just now have realized that T60 and new T400 have also both pcmcia and expresscards. T43 are at good prices on ebay, but on my searching I have found the new SLx series, and lenovo G550 at very good prices, around 400 in euro, so I´m not sure what to do. About the G550 haven´t found much info really, and have seen no info in this forum, for the SLx series, they seem to be ok, good performance, should be new and would have warranty.
Since I´ll keep my actual T40 can live with only Expresscard, but what about SLx battery life?

My preferences are,battery life, lightness and thinness, expresscard.
Issues like gaming, or super-performance are secondary, I really think it´s better a desktop for that.
Regarding the T series, should you recomend T43? T60? T62?
Have seen T400 and seems attractive, around 700 euro I think, but I remember that not such time ago a T60 cost more than that, and now is already an "old model", so even I could invest 700 euro, should it worth?, I could buy near two used T43 with that.
I´ll wait for your opinions and comments, I´m really undecided, and quite confused. But at least, love Lenovo. :thumbs-UP:

I'd say go for T60...modern enough machine when compared to any T4x, faster and more reliable...and should be affordable at this point in time.

That's the advice I'd give someone buying a laptop on U.S. market...the one in Spain is terra incognita for me...

I highly endorse the T60 if buying used. Noticing your edit, the T400 is a particularly good buy new, at the present time. Yet that said I don't expect them to be available much longer since the T410 has just become available.
